Azerbaijan announces monitoring results of pollution of transboundary rivers

Azerbaijan, Baku, June 22 / Trend K. Zarbaliyeva /

The Ministry of Environment and Natural Resources has monitored the level of pollution of transboundary rivers in mid-June, the Ministry told Trend.

The results of monitoring, the number of nutrients in the river Kura significantly exceed the norm due to untreated domestic and industrial wastes into the water on the territory of Georgia and Armenia.

Phenol and copper compounds contained in water are significantly higher than the permissible norm.

Content of phenol in water exceeds the norm four times, copper compounds - three times in  Shikhli-2; phenol - twice, copper compounds - three times in Agstafachay, phenol - twice, copper compounds - three times in the reservoir Agstafachay.

In mid-June, water flow in the river Kura, decreased by 61 cubic meters per second and reached 432 cubic meters compared to the first decade.

Water flow in the river Araz was 499 cubic meters per second.
